Use in autoimmune disease is also supported by Centurys preclinical data demonstrating CNTY-101s ability to elicit more potent in vitro killing of B-cells from healthy donors and SLE patients as compared to primary CAR-T cells, as well as the encouraging initial safety, efficacy, and translational data from Centurys Phase 1 ELiPSE-1 trial in relapsed/refractory (R/R) non-Hodgkin lymphoma (NHL).Century plans to evaluate CNTY-101 in moderate to severe SLE in the Phase 1 CALiPSO-1 trial ( ), the first autoimmune disease indication for its platform.
